Undigested Medication?

Okay, so I know this is a gross question...but it something that I really want/need to know the answer to.  I seem to be passing totally undigested Venlafaxine XR (Effexor XR) pills.  I managed to inspect one of the pills afterward (disgusting, I know) and the outside was tough but it was still full of a white, powdery substance.  Does this mean that I'm not digesting the medication at all?  What should I do?

WorriedOne, call your pharmacist and ask him/her if what you're taking is made to pass through what may be something that looks undigested. There are some medications that are formulated to do exactly that - althought the white, powdery substance you noted sounds like something else is going on - but it's a place to start. If the pharmacist says no, call your doc and discuss the issue.
